The Seven Daughters of Eve
The Seven Daughters of Eve | Bryan Sykes
A scientist describes how he linked the DNA found in the remains of a five-thousand-year-old man to modern-day relatives and explains how all modern individuals can trace their genetic makeup back to prehistoric times to seven primeval women.

I love this book on the science behind the ancient secret we all harbor: the "name" of our maternal ancestor. Mito DNA is only inheritable from our mother, so it passes from mother, to daughter, & so on, & so forth, back to a single common female ancestor. It mutates roughly once every 10k yrs, so it is a slow clock. These are my inheritrices, River & Cleopatra, ultimately daughters of Ulrike, daughter of Ursula, daughter of Eve. #5monthsold
